Emilia Isobel Euphemia Rose Clarke is an English actress. She rose to prominence in her breakthrough role as Daenerys Targaryen in the HBO fantasy television series Game of Thrones. Her film roles include Sarah Connor in the science fiction film Terminator Genisys and Qi’ra in the Star Wars film Solo: A Star Wars Story. In 2018, she was honoured by the British Academy of Film and Television Arts with the British Artist of the Year award. Time magazine named her one of the 100 most influential people in the world in 2019.
